ABOUT THE JOB:
- Opportunity to work in a fast passed, dynamic, architectural fabrication company. The Machining/Fabrication Supervisor’s responsibility is to lead and develop a team of machine operators and fabricators, maintain and develop work standards, while ensuring quality of work is met. Candidate must be a motivated self-starter and comfortable with taking ownership of processes and procedures within their department. This position is ideal for an individual who is looking for advancement from a cell or team leader position.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Provide team with direction, priorities, focus and boundaries.
- Develop cooperation and teamwork while leading a diverse group of people, working towards solutions which balance business, customer, and associate needs. This includes an ability to work with others easily, establishing a climate of trust, confidence, and mutual respect.
- Develop and prioritizes departmental schedules and work with the Plant Manager on manpower requirements.
- Encourage communication and feedback amongst work group.
- Assist in maintaining an effective operating department by controlling activity within prescribed quality standards, production levels, and cost levels, while keeping a focus on safety and manufacturing objectives.
- In conjunction with the Plant Manager, develop process improvements, changes in equipment, tooling or manufacturing processes.
- Maintain required information and records necessary for efficient operations and controls. Maintain production standards in areas of responsibility.
- Promotes safe work habits of subordinates and compliance with safety rules in work areas. Maintains and clean and orderly work environment.
- Interact with other areas in the company to accomplish timely workflow.
- Perform the job with minimal supervision.
- Perform other duties and/or tasks as assigned.
EDUCATION / EXPERIENCE:
- 3-5 years solid supervisory experience in a Machine shop facility.
- 3-5 years' experience in a fabrication department (architectural applications).
- Experience with welding, brake presses, waterjets and punch presses.
- Experience in G-Code programming. Hurco VMC experience a plus.
- Understanding of calculating stretch-out's on bend panel applications.
- Job Shop CNC machine setup experience.
- Previous experience implementing Lean Manufacturing Projects.
- Effective written and verbal communication skills, interpersonal skills, and demonstrated ability to interact and interface with production personnel as well as management.
- Familiarity with a multi-departmental manufacturing environment.
- Union experience within a supervisory role a plus.
- Knowledge of production planning.
- Independent worker (must be able to assign and complete assignments independently).
- High School Diploma or equivalent.
- Able to read and interpret engineering drawings and blueprints.
- Strong mechanical aptitude.
- Fluent in use of Microsoft applications including Excel, Outlook, and Word and use of production software application
